Kolkata hotel fire prompts notices for 26 establishments

A fire happened at Shikha Inn in Kolkata.

Nine people died, mostly because they could not breathe through the smoke.

After the fire, officials checked other hotels nearby.

They found concerns about fire-safety arrangements at 26 hotels and guesthouses.

Seventeen of those establishments received notices on Friday.

They must explain themselves within 24 hours or may be ordered to close.

Police arrested the hotel’s leaseholder, while the original owner is still missing.

The government also ordered a wider safety audit of hotels in the area.

Key facts

Additional notices
Seventeen hotels received show-cause notices on Friday.
Total establishments notified
Twenty-six hotels and guesthouses in and around the area have received notices.
Response deadline
The 17 establishments notified on Friday must respond within 24 hours.
Death toll
Nine people died, including six males, two women, and one child.
Bangladeshi victims
Seven of those killed were residents of Bangladesh.
Arrest
Leaseholder Abu Zafar was arrested and remanded to police custody until September 2.
Government response
West Bengal announced a special audit of hotels, lodges, and guesthouses in the area.
